>      still seem to be all but incapable of controlling the flex shaft,
>     each time I need to set a stone. In the hands of all my
>     right-handed colleagues and former instructors, this invaluable
>     tool seems relatively easily controlled: just squeeze the fingers
>     tighter and stiffen the hand into a vise-like grip, and away you
>     go! The only problem is, when the *(%$^&)tool's in the left hand,
>     there aren't enough opposing fingers, 

    Hello Doug Flexi-shaft is very friendly with lefties....I find it
    difficult to understand your difficulties. Unless you are sitting on
    a right-hand person's bench? and so having your flex-shaft motor
    hanging on your right...? I'm left-handed, there are some difficulties
    with certain tools, but flex-shaft, hanging on your left side, and
    held with your left hand, should give u the same control as
    right-handed has. In case your flex-shaft is a general purpose  one
    [like Freedom] then it might takes  more getting used to. Or, perhaps
    you need a more fancy machine... meant for precision work....? Using a
    Micro-motor, is a much more flexible and precise option....no
    jerk-start, no limitation of working angle, minimal distance from
    bur tip, to the holding fingers.....and it leaves the lefties to
    their creativity.
